Why Software Robot Projects Fail in Automation Program Design
Most enterprises see their digital transformation initiatives stall because software robot projects fail in automation program design at the architectural level. By focusing solely on task-level speed rather than end-to-end process integrity, organizations create technical debt that dwarfs any efficiency gains. If your automation strategy lacks a robust RPA foundation, you are essentially scaling inefficiency. Bridging this gap requires shifting from tactical scripting to a systemic, enterprise-wide design philosophy.
The Architecture of Automation Failure
The primary reason for failure is the attempt to automate brittle, legacy processes without re-engineering the underlying logic. When teams force high-volume RPA deployment onto broken workflows, the robots become massive liabilities rather than assets. These projects fail because they ignore the systemic architecture required for high-availability production environments.
- Opaque Process Mapping: Automating processes that are poorly understood or undocumented leads to frequent robot downtime.
- Lack of Scalability: Designing bots as standalone scripts rather than as part of a modular framework prevents reuse and enterprise-wide scaling.
- Ignoring Exception Handling: Enterprises often underestimate the volume of edge cases, leading to operational bottlenecks when bots inevitably encounter deviations.
The missing insight here is that automation is a change management challenge masquerading as a technical one.
Strategic Alignment and Operational Resilience
A mature automation program design demands an alignment between technology, operations, and risk management. Many leaders treat robotics as a “set and forget” utility, failing to integrate it with IT governance and compliance frameworks. Without a centralized oversight mechanism, shadow automation emerges, introducing significant security vulnerabilities and data integrity risks across departments.
Successful implementation requires treating bots as digital workers with specific lifecycles, monitoring requirements, and security clearance. The trade-off is higher upfront design costs, but this significantly reduces the total cost of ownership over the project lifecycle. Focus on building “self-healing” automation routines that handle routine errors autonomously, freeing your technical teams to focus on high-value digital transformation initiatives rather than constant bot maintenance and firefighting.
Key Challenges
Enterprises frequently struggle with fragmented data silos and lack of standardized APIs, which forces bots to scrape legacy UIs. This approach is inherently unstable and leads to project abandonment.
Best Practices
Adopt a “process first” mindset. Audit every workflow for efficiency before applying automation, and prioritize modular, reusable bot components to ensure long-term maintainability.
Governance Alignment
Integrate automated audit trails into your design. Ensuring every robot interaction is logged and compliant with industry regulations is not optional; it is a prerequisite for enterprise viability.
How Neotechie Can Help
At Neotechie, we specialize in rescuing stalled automation programs by aligning technical execution with your strategic business goals. We leverage deep expertise in RPA and agentic automation to transform rigid workflows into resilient, scalable digital systems. Whether you need to fix broken bot architectures or build a new governance framework, our consultants ensure your digital transformation delivers measurable ROI. We focus on building enterprise-grade automation that scales safely across your operations, turning your automation program from a liability into a core business driver.
Conclusion
Avoiding the common pitfalls in software robot design requires shifting from task-based tactics to long-term architectural strategy. By prioritizing governance and modularity, you ensure your automation investments deliver sustainable value. Neotechie is a proud partner of leading platforms like Automation Anywhere, UiPath, and Microsoft Power Automate, ensuring your infrastructure is built on the best technology available. When done correctly, your software robot projects become the engine of your digital transformation.
For more information contact us at Neotechie
Q: How do I identify if my automation project is failing?
A: Look for rising maintenance costs, high exception rates, and a lack of scalability despite having many bots in production. These symptoms indicate an underlying failure in the original program design.
Q: Why is IT governance critical for RPA success?
A: Without governance, your bots operate without oversight, creating compliance risks and data silos. Proper frameworks ensure that automation remains secure and aligned with corporate standards.
Q: Can we automate a process without re-engineering it?
A: While possible, automating an inefficient process simply makes your problems execute faster. True ROI comes from optimizing the workflow before implementing digital labor.


Leave a Reply